Scorpion Design Kicks Off Charity Competition
The Scorpion Design team is defined by a desire to give back and a playfully competitive spirit —and when those two characteristics combine, the internet marketing firm produces an extremely successful charity competition.
Each year, all 270-plus Scorpion employees break into teams and try to raise the most money for their selected non-profit as a way to give back and bond as a company. Last year, teams collectively raised $45,000 over a four-week period. This year, four teams aim to raise $50,000 each over five weeks, for a grand total of $200,000 in non-profit donations.
“We enjoy helping people outside of our company,” said Kylie Patterson, Director of PR, Events, & Recruitment at Scorpion, “And it’s good for us to bond together while doing something that’s bigger than ourselves and even business.”
Once employee teams are established, each chooses a non-profit. This year, Scorpion has selected the Michael Hoefflin Foundation for Children’s Cancer, A Light of Hope, The Dawg Squad, and City of Hope. These non-profits are close to the hearts of many Scorpion employees.
“These charities are all important to the Scorpion team. For example, one employee survived a battle with leukemia thanks in part to a bone marrow match at City of Hope,” said Kylie. “Multiple dogs have been adopted by employees via The Dawg Squad.”
Scorpion teams are reaching out to friends, family, clients, and more via social media to raise funds. Community members can join the competition and donate through four online pages, now receiving donations through December 4.
The competition is supported by Scorpion Cares, the non-profit branch of Scorpion Design that was created by Kylie in 2011 as a way to invest in the community that supports them as well as the hometown of the majority of their employees. “We work in a really collaborative environment, so we enjoy activities that promote our team-based attitude,” said Kylie. “We love the opportunity to feel like we’re working on something meaningful together.”
